Question: | I understand that this product is also recognized as being "Agent Orange |
Answer: | It was half of the concoction. The other was 2,4,5-t which is now a restricted use product and can only be bought with a license. |
Question: | Is this product safe for use on St. Augustine lawns |
Answer: | 2, 4-D is a generic broad leaf weed killer found in almost all broadleaf herbicides. Since St. Augustine is a grass (and not a broadleaf), 2,4-D will not kill it. However, if used again and again in a particular location, it will eventually kill the St. Augustine which is what I experienced in a small patch which had oxalis (yellow sorrel) weed. I later found out from Texas A&M that oxalis, albeit a broadleaf, is very, very hard to kill since it has underground rhizomes which regenerate the weed even if it appears to have been killed. Their recommendation for a broadleaf weedkiller a homeowner could use (i.e., you don't have to have a applicator's license) was $64.99 for 2 ozs, so I passed. Think I'll try to hand dig my oxalis. |

CONTAINS: 3.8 lbs. per gallon 2, 4-D acid equivalent liquid concentrate in a low volatile amine form.
USE ON: Certain grasses in lawns, parks,golf courses, and pastures; fences, ditch banks, non-crop sites, small grains, and corn (pre and post emergent herbicide)
CONTROLS: Many broad-leaf weeds.
RATE: 2- 3 tablespoons in 3 – 5 gallons of water to cover 1,000 sq. ft.
APPLICATION: Apply as a coarse low pressure spray, preferably with fan type nozzle.

Question: | How much do I use for crabgrass |
Answer: | This stuff contains Quinclorac which is the same stuff we used commercially with good results. The thing about crabgrass, (or any undesirable grasses), is they take a long time to kill. You can up the dosage but take the risk of killing the good grass as well. When Crabgrass starts to die, it first turns colors or red, purple or orange. It will not disappear completely like dandelions or any broadleaf. However it will not come back the next year. That said, this Quinclorac does not prevent any new seeds from sprouting which is what you might have had. Crabgrass puts out a tremendous amount of seeds each year if not killed early enough. (They only spread by seeds and all of it dies at the first frost. ) The key is to hit it hard and often early when it first sprouts before it goes to seed. Any weed seeds can last up to 5 years in the soil before they germinate depending on the soil moisture and temperature. This is why you may see new weeds when you disturb the soil in any way. A lush thick lawn will keep the soil temps down and many seeds will rot before germinating. This is why crabgrass and other weeds tend to sprout next to driveways, etc. because the temps are higher. A neglected, (problem) lawn can take 3-4 years of constant attention to become weed free. Your first application in the spring should be a strong fert with pre-emergent. This will kill off any seeds, (including grass seeds), that try to germinate. Pre-emergent lasts about 90 days. As the temps get hotter, back off on the fert, (unless you water in between the raindrops), and spot treat weeds as needed. No need to weed control the whole lawn as this is a waste. In the fall as temps drop and rain comes back, step up the fert and weed killer again. If you plan to spread new seed wait until fall. The temps are lower, there is usually more rain, the pre-emergent is done, and traffic on the lawn is mostly done. When reseeding, stay off the lawn as much as possible. No foot traffic, dogs, or weed control. I always told my customers to seed an area that they could cover with a few sprinklers and an automatic timer. Otherwise the seed won't take. Also, stay off the lawn when there is frost on it as you can kill the grass. Unfortunately, a very lush, thick lawn is fairly expensive as it can require a lot of water and or chemicals. A full sun lawn requires much more water than a shaded lawn, but recovers from damage quicker. The best lawns I have seen had an underground sprinkler system and had a good, timed lawn care service. Once we got the weeds under control in such a lawn, they required little, if any, weed killer. |
